A Record Company Used To Be A Very Good Thing, But They Ended Up Soul-destroyingly Trapping People In The Accounting Department. And You Couldn't Get Any Further, And The Heads Of Each Department Were Changing All The Time, So You Couldn't Have Any Permanent Relationship Within The Corporation.
-John Lydon
